AfterNext HealthTech Acquisition Corp., established in 2021 and based in Fort Worth, Texas, currently conducts no substantial operations. Its primary objective is to complete a business combination—which could take the form of a merger, capital stock exchange, asset purchase, stock acquisition, or reorganization—with one or more active companies or assets specifically within the healthcare and technology sectors.
